做temu怎么避坑

2024-12-14

在搭建Temu平台时,开发者们常常会遇到各种挑战和陷阱。为了避免这些潜在的坑洼,我们需要深入了解Temu平台的特性,以及可能遇到的问题。以下是一些关键的避坑指南,帮助您在开发过程中更加顺利。

一、了解Temu平台的基本架构

在开始开发之前,深入了解Temu平台的基本架构至关重要。Temu是一个基于React Native的跨平台应用程序,这意味着它可以在iOS和Android上运行。开发者需要熟悉React Native的基本概念,包括组件、状态管理、以及生命周期函数。此外,了解Temu的API结构和后端服务也是必要的,这有助于在开发过程中避免不必要的错误。

二、合理规划数据结构和状态管理

Temu平台涉及大量的数据交互和状态管理。在开发过程中,合理规划数据结构和使用合适的状态管理库至关重要。以下是一些关键点:

- **避免过度使用全局状态管理**:虽然Redux等全局状态管理工具在处理复杂应用时非常有用,但过度使用可能会导致性能问题。在可能的情况下,尽量使用React的本地状态管理(如useState和useReducer)。

- **优化数据结构**:确保数据结构简洁明了,避免冗余和重复。合理使用数组、对象和映射,以提高数据处理的效率。

- **使用异步操作处理数据**:Temu平台的数据请求通常涉及异步操作。使用async和await关键字,以及合适的错误处理机制,可以确保数据请求的稳定性和可靠性。

三、注意界面设计和用户体验

Temu平台的用户界面设计对其成功至关重要。以下是一些设计方面的注意事项:

- **保持界面简洁**:避免过度装饰和复杂的布局。简洁的界面不仅美观,还能提高用户的操作效率。

- **优化响应速度**:确保应用的响应速度足够快,避免长时间等待。优化图片和资源加载,以及减少不必要的重渲染,都是提高响应速度的有效方法。

- **考虑不同屏幕尺寸**:Temu平台支持多种设备,因此需要确保应用在不同屏幕尺寸和分辨率下都能良好运行。

四、加强安全性措施

在数字化时代,安全性是任何应用程序不可或缺的一部分。以下是一些加强Temu平台安全性的措施:

- **数据加密**:确保所有敏感数据都经过加密处理,包括用户信息、交易数据等。

- **身份验证和授权**:实施强健的身份验证和授权机制,以防止未授权访问。

- **定期更新和漏洞修复**:及时更新应用程序,修复已知的安全漏洞,以防止潜在的安全威胁。

五、持续测试和优化

开发完成后,持续测试和优化是确保Temu平台稳定运行的关键。以下是一些建议:

- **自动化测试**:实施自动化测试,包括单元测试、集成测试和性能测试,以确保代码的质量和稳定性。

- **性能监控**:使用性能监控工具,实时跟踪应用的性能指标,及时发现并解决性能问题。

- **用户反馈**:积极收集用户反馈,了解他们的需求和问题,不断优化用户体验。

通过以上措施,开发者可以更好地避免在Temu平台开发过程中遇到的各种坑洼,从而打造出更加稳定、安全、用户体验良好的应用程序。在数字化时代,持续学习和适应新技术,是每个开发者必备的素质。

标签:

版权声明

AI导航网内容全部来自网络,版权争议与本站无关,如果您认为侵犯了您的合法权益,请联系我们删除,并向所有持版权者致最深歉意!本站所发布的一切学习教程、软件等资料仅限用于学习体验和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。请自觉下载后24小时内删除,如果您喜欢该资料,请支持正版!

流量卡